WebArsenite can typically form three-coordinate trigonal–pyramidal complexes with three cysteines in proteins, which can disrupt the activity of certain enzymes. Arsenate usually disrupts cellular processes as a phosphate mimic, but has weak inter-action with proteins. WebPentavalent arsenate uncouples mitochondrial oxidative phosphorylation by competing with phosphate in the formation of adenosine triphosphate. Orally ingested arsenicals are taken up in high concentrations by intestinal epithelial cells and act intracellularly to disrupt energy production and enzyme activity.
